What is the difference between Intern Databricks Data Engineer vs Intern Data Analyst?

AspectIntern Databricks Data EngineerIntern Data Analyst
Required SkillsSQL, Python, Spark, Databricks platformExcel, SQL, data visualization tools
Work EnvironmentData engineering teams, cloud platformsBusiness intelligence teams, reporting environments
Industry UsageTech, finance, healthcareRetail, marketing, finance

Intern Databricks Data Engineers focus on building data pipelines and managing large-scale data workflows using Databricks and Spark, while Intern Data Analysts primarily analyze data and create reports. Both roles require SQL and basic programming skills, but Data Engineers need more technical expertise in data infrastructure, whereas Data Analysts focus on interpreting data for business insights.

Job description

SUMMARY:

Working within the Finance Data Team, the Data Engineer develops modern data pipelines inside of cloud-based data platforms to provide financial business intelligence and enable data-driven decision-making. The role partners closely with Finance leadership, Accounting, FP&A, Treasury, Tax, IT, and business stakeholders to deliver high-quality data solutions that improve reporting efficiency, strengthen controls, and support strategic initiatives. As a member of the Finance Data Team, the data engineer serves as a critical support for the bridge between Finance and Technology, ensuring that financial data is accurate, accessible, and trusted across the organization.

This role requires a strong background in database design, with the primary focus on designing, developing, and maintaining ETL pipelines within cloud-based data platforms. This role reports to the Business Intelligence Manager inside of Finance and requires collaboration with both finance and IT teams to gather requirements and deliver solutions. A strong candidate will have a passion for data, analytical skills and Finance knowledge. This, coupled with the ability to leverage deep technical expertise, will allow for the efficient creation of accurate and actionable data sets.

JOB DUTIES

Designs, builds, and maintains scalable data pipelines and ETL processes to support financial reporting, operational analysis, and business intelligence needs.

Designs and manages data security frameworks, including role-level security (RLS) and permissions across Finance's Power BI workspaces, ensuring appropriate access controls aligned with Finance data governance requirements.

Develops, and implements sematic layers for consumption in PowerBI dashboards and visualizations.

Maintains data models optimized for finance use cases.

Develops processes to monitor data integrity including reconciliation, and exception reporting.

Collaborate with software developers and data scientists to support advanced analytics and AI initiatives.

Ensures alignment of team objectives with business goals, coordinating with stakeholders in finance, accounting, and other departments.

Utilize visualization techniques and BI Tools (Power BI & Qlik) to present findings in a clear, actionable format.

Defines project scope, deliverables and timelines, ensuring on-time, high quality products.

Continuously monitors emerging technologies and industry trends, ensuring the preservation of a competitive advantage while promoting the enhancement of organizational capabilities.

Performs other duties as assigned.

EDUCATION & EXPERIENCE

Requires a b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Information Systems, Data Engineering, Finance, Accounting or related field.

At least five (5) years of experience in data engineering or related technical roles.

KNOWLEDGE, SKILLS, ABILITIES

Strong SQL development and database design experience.

Experience building ETL pipelines using modern data integration tools.

Proficiency in Python, PySpark, Databricks or similar data engineering technologies.

Experience with cloud data platforms such as Snowflake, Azure, AWS, or Google Cloud.

Strong knowledge of data engineering principles, including experience with data warehousing, and big data technologies.

Experience working with ERP and financial systems such as SAP, Oracle, Workday, or similar platforms.

Strong analytical and problem-solving skills.

Communication, presentation, and interpersonal skills, with the ability to convey complex concepts to diverse audiences.

Proven track record of successful project management, including the ability to prioritize tasks, manage deadlines, and ensure the delivery of high-quality solutions.

Industry-specific domain knowledge in Finance or Accounting, with an understanding of related processes and terminology is preferred.

Experience with data visualization tools (Qlik, PowerBI, etc.) preferred.
